The film 'Saalar' will be released in two parts. The first part of the film has been released today and the post-credit scenes of its second part have also been officially announced. A video of this is going viral on social media. At the end of the video, 'Salaar: Part 2 Shauryang Parvam' appears on the screen.
Let us tell you that 'Saalar' is based on the story of two friends. In this, Prabhas and Prithviraj Sukumaran are seen in the role of friends. The film has been given an A certificate by the Censor Board, and the reason behind this is that its story contains many bloody wars and violent scenes.
After the release, 'Salaar' is getting a positive response on social media. The film is being appreciated a lot by the users in the Twitter review. Along with the acting of Prabhas and Prithviraj, people are also praising the direction of Prashant Neel.
Let us tell you that 'Salaar' is competing with Shahrukh Khan's film 'Dinky' at the box office. 'Dinky' is released in theaters on Thursday i.e. 21st December. Vicky Kaushal and Taapsee Pannu are also seen in important roles in this film directed by Rajkumar Hirani. It will be interesting to see where Prabhas stands in the competition with Shahrukh Khan!
